n With an objective of providing better health care facilities in the far flung areas of the state, the Shri Guru Ram Rai (SGRR) University entered into a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Himalayan Garhwal University (HGU) on Friday. The document was signed by the VC of the SGRR University, Pitambar Prasad Dhyani and Nanad Kishore Sinha on behalf of Himalayan Garhwal University. A communiqué from the SGRR University claims that both the universities will be organizing free health camps at the remote and very remote areas in the mountainous areas with the help of the Mahant Indiresh Hospital.
The VC of the SGRR University informed that prior to this SGRR University had signed MoUs with many national and international institutions.
He added that the MoU of Saturday is 10th such MoU of the university. The SGRR University had also signed an important MoU with Himalayan Universities Consortium on an international level. Himalayan Universities consortium is an association of 62 renowned universities of the world. After the MOU, SGRR University has got associated with 62 renowned universities.
